Prestonpans (ˌprɛstənˈpænz) [Click for IPA pronunciation guide]
 
n
a small town and resort in SE Scotland, in East Lothian on the Firth of Forth: scene of the battle (1745) in which the Jacobite army of Prince Charles Edward defeated government forces under Sir John Cope. Pop: 7153 (2001)
